RECOMMENDATION(S):

ADOPT Position Adjustment Resolution No. 21414 to add one (1) Information Systems Programmer/Analyst I (LPWA) (represented) position at salary plan and grade ZB5 1496 ($4,570 - $5,555) in the Department of Information Technology.

FISCAL IMPACT:

Upon approval, this action will result in an annual cost of $98,720 to the Department of Information Technology.   
  

DoIT charges for all services and these charges include revenue generated from non-general fund departments and other public agencies. The cost of this position would be included in the charges to our users.


BACKGROUND:

PeopleSoft is the core for processing all personnel transactions, benefits, and information pertinent to providing employees with benefits and pay. Human Resources and the Auditor Controller use it to process all employee actions and assure employees are paid correctly. All departments use PeopleSoft to enter HR transactions.   
  
IT staff that currently support PeopleSoft are approaching retirement within the next 3-4 years and viable replacements must be found and adequately trained to maintain sufficient support to assure that the departments, Human Resources and Auditor Controller are technically supported. It takes at least two years for a junior analyst to be trained to independently provide support to the departments. If IT support is not adequate, delays in processing and resolving system problems could occur, which could impact employees being paid on time.   
  
The PeopleSoft Steering Committee has approved the addition of one ISPA position to the DoIT support staff. Since Payroll and Human Resource functions are critical to this County, DoIT support of these functions is just as critical. It is imperative that we start to develop the next generation of this support now, so that adequate support will be seamless.   
  
In addition, once the current timekeeping project, ADP eTime, is implemented, the Steering Committee will need to consider a PeopleSoft upgrade as the product is no longer in support. This also will require additional staff as resources to act on this project while maintaining sufficient support to run Payroll process.

CONSEQUENCE OF NEGATIVE ACTION:

DoIT will not be able to properly support the critical County Payroll and Human Resources functions.
